The ingredients needed to cook Leftover Turkey Slider with Cranberry Coleslaw:

  1. Use of Slider (small) buns.
  2. Use of Left over Turkey (roasted or fried).
  3. Get of Chipotle mayo.
  4. Prepare 1 pkg of shredded cabbage.
  5. You need 1/2-3/4 cup of whole Berry Cranberry sauce (left over).
  6. Take 1 tbsp of orange juice.
  7. Prepare 3/4-1 cup of mayo.
  8. Use to taste of Salt & pepper.

Steps to make Leftover Turkey Slider with Cranberry Coleslaw:

  1. Mix together Cranberry sauce, Mayo, orange juice and salt & pepper..
  2. Stir into the shredded cabbage. Adjust seasoning if needed..
  3. Assemble sandwich. Small bun, chipotle mayo, turkey and Cranberry Coleslaw. Enjoy your leftovers..
